The category: Italian, highlights the national and linguistic identity of people, associated with Italy and Italian language and culture.

Overview

The Italians are the citizens of Italy as well as the majority ethnic group that originated from that country (circa 131 million). They primarily speak the Italian language.

Most Italians (circa 56 million) today live within the borders of independent Italy. There are Italian minorities in nearby Switzerland, Croatia, France, and sizeable populations of immigrants and their descendants in South America, the United States, Canada, Australia, Germany, and other countries.
